Transaction ebd1eaf2a23405c783b41f800ec0cad91df890aafba0ad147744af210fc5435b
1 Input
1 Output
-
ebd1eaf2a23405c783b41f800ec0cad91df890aafba0ad147744af210fc5435b:0
- value
- 674299040
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c314d679c62a58bab7f51f78e4b6bd619d1253b5 OP_EQUAL
- address
- MRgexfxghResnzfefKFbgQYooU6uD1fjwi